Understanding Block Paving in Hugh Town

Block paving is a popular choice for driveways, patios, and pathways, offering both aesthetic appeal and durability. In Hugh Town, the charm of block paving is evident in its widespread use. This article delves into the various aspects of block paving in Hugh Town, providing insights into its benefits, types, installation process, and maintenance tips.

The Appeal of Block Paving

Block paving has become a preferred choice for many homeowners and businesses in Hugh Town. Its appeal lies in the versatility and elegance it brings to outdoor spaces. The variety of colours, shapes, and patterns available allows for a personalised touch, enhancing the overall look of any property.

Benefits of Block Paving

  • Durability: Block paving is known for its long-lasting nature, capable of withstanding heavy loads and harsh weather conditions.
  • Low Maintenance: Once installed, block paving requires minimal upkeep, making it a cost-effective option in the long run.
  • Eco-Friendly: Many block paving materials are permeable, allowing water to drain naturally and reducing the risk of flooding.
  • Versatility: With a wide range of styles and colours, block paving can be tailored to suit any design preference.

Types of Block Paving

In Hugh Town, several types of block paving are available, each offering unique characteristics. Choosing the right type depends on the specific needs and aesthetic preferences of the property owner.

Concrete Block Paving

Concrete blocks are a popular choice due to their affordability and strength. They come in various shapes and sizes, allowing for creative designs. Concrete block paving is ideal for driveways and areas with heavy foot traffic.

Clay Block Paving

Clay blocks offer a natural and timeless look, often preferred for their rich colours and durability. Although slightly more expensive than concrete, clay block paving provides a classic appearance that ages beautifully over time.

Natural Stone Paving

Natural stone paving, such as granite or sandstone, offers a luxurious finish. While it is the most expensive option, its unique textures and colours make it a worthwhile investment for those seeking a high-end look.

Installation Process of Block Paving

Installing block paving in Hugh Town involves several steps to ensure a durable and visually appealing result. Proper preparation and execution are crucial for a successful installation.

Site Preparation

The first step in the installation process is preparing the site. This involves clearing the area of any debris, vegetation, or existing paving. The ground is then excavated to the required depth, ensuring a stable foundation for the blocks.

Base Layer Installation

A base layer of crushed stone or gravel is laid and compacted to provide a solid foundation. This layer is crucial for drainage and preventing the paving from shifting over time.

Laying the Blocks

Once the base layer is prepared, the blocks are laid in the desired pattern. Precision is key during this step to ensure even spacing and alignment. Edging restraints are installed to keep the blocks in place.

Joint Filling and Compaction

After the blocks are laid, sand is brushed into the joints to lock them in place. The entire surface is then compacted using a plate compactor, ensuring a level and stable finish.

Maintaining Block Paving

Proper maintenance is essential to preserve the appearance and longevity of block paving. Regular care can prevent common issues such as weed growth and surface staining.

Regular Cleaning

Keeping the surface clean is vital for maintaining its aesthetic appeal. Regular sweeping and occasional washing with a mild detergent can remove dirt and prevent stains.

Weed Control

Weeds can grow in the joints between blocks, detracting from the paving's appearance. Applying a weed killer or using a pressure washer can help control unwanted growth.

Repairing Damaged Areas

Over time, some blocks may become damaged or dislodged. Promptly replacing or repositioning these blocks can prevent further issues and maintain the integrity of the paving.

Cost Considerations for Block Paving

The cost of block paving in Hugh Town can vary based on several factors, including the type of material, the size of the area, and the complexity of the design.

Material Costs

Concrete blocks are generally the most affordable option, while natural stone tends to be more expensive. The choice of material will significantly impact the overall cost.

Labour Costs

Labour costs can vary depending on the complexity of the installation and the experience of the contractor. It's essential to obtain multiple quotes to ensure a fair price.

Additional Expenses

Additional costs may include site preparation, waste disposal, and any necessary permits. These should be factored into the overall budget for the project.

Environmental Impact of Block Paving

Block paving can have both positive and negative environmental impacts. Understanding these can help in making informed decisions about materials and installation methods.

Permeable Paving Options

Permeable block paving allows water to drain through the surface, reducing runoff and the risk of flooding. This environmentally friendly option is increasingly popular in urban areas.

Material Sourcing

Choosing locally sourced materials can reduce the environmental impact associated with transportation. Additionally, some materials are more sustainable than others, such as recycled concrete or natural stone.

Long-Term Sustainability

Block paving's durability means it requires less frequent replacement, reducing waste and resource consumption over time. Proper maintenance can further extend its lifespan, contributing to sustainability.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• What is the lifespan of block paving? With proper maintenance, block paving can last 20-25 years or more.
  • Can block paving be installed in any weather? It's best to install block paving in dry conditions to ensure proper setting and compaction.
  • How do I prevent weeds in block paving? Regular cleaning and applying a weed killer can help prevent weed growth.
  • Is block paving suitable for all types of driveways? Yes, block paving is versatile and can be used for various driveway designs and sizes.
  • What is the cost of block paving per square metre? Costs can vary, but on average, it ranges from £50 to £100 per square metre, including materials and labour.
  • Can I install block paving myself? While possible, professional installation is recommended for the best results and longevity.
